A helical gear generator is a specialized machine tool, most commonly a or a gear shaper , designed to produce gears with a helical profile. The term "generator" refers to the kinematic process where the cutting tool and the workpiece perform a synchronized, continuous rotation and linear movement to create the tooth profile.
